Zach Hoffman Overpowers Hicham Bouzoubaa in Frisco Winter Blast Tournament Quarterfinals

Zach Hoffman Overpowers Hicham Bouzoubaa: Zach Hoffman defeated Hicham Bouzoubaa 15-7 in a Men’s Singles (3.5 skill level) quarterfinals match at the Life Time Frisco Winter Blast Tournament on January 12, 2025. The match took place on Court 7 in Frisco, Texas, with Hoffman showing clear control throughout the game.
